a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/libertas/cmd.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/libertas/cmd.c')
-rw-r--r--drivers/net/wireless/libertas/cmd.c9
1 files changed, 4 insertions, 5 deletions
diff --git a/drivers/net/wireless/libertas/cmd.c b/drivers/net/wireless/libertas/cmd.c
index be461c5c42ae..be8a170b633f 100644
--- a/drivers/net/wireless/libertas/cmd.c
+++ b/drivers/net/wireless/libertas/cmd.c
@@ -1326,9 +1326,8 @@ int lbs_set_radio_control(struct lbs_private *priv)
1326 return ret; 1326 return ret;
1327} 1327}
1328 1328
1329int lbs_set_mac_control(struct lbs_private *priv) 1329void lbs_set_mac_control(struct lbs_private *priv)
1330{ 1330{
1331 int ret = 0;
1332 struct cmd_ds_mac_control cmd; 1331 struct cmd_ds_mac_control cmd;
1333 1332
1334 lbs_deb_enter(LBS_DEB_CMD); 1333 lbs_deb_enter(LBS_DEB_CMD);
@@ -1337,10 +1336,10 @@ int lbs_set_mac_control(struct lbs_private *priv)
1337 cmd.action = cpu_to_le16(priv->mac_control); 1336 cmd.action = cpu_to_le16(priv->mac_control);
1338 cmd.reserved = 0; 1337 cmd.reserved = 0;
1339 1338
1340 ret = lbs_cmd_with_response(priv, CMD_MAC_CONTROL, &cmd); 1339 lbs_cmd_async(priv, CMD_MAC_CONTROL,
1340 &cmd.hdr, sizeof(cmd));
1341 1341
1342 lbs_deb_leave_args(LBS_DEB_CMD, "ret %d", ret); 1342 lbs_deb_leave(LBS_DEB_CMD);
1343 return ret;
1344} 1343}
1345 1344
1346/** 1345/**